Subject: TimeGrid solver — integration status

Team,

Solver API v3 is live on staging. Breaking change: constraint payloads now require explicit room capacities. Pellhurst Academy pilot data is loaded. Batch solves cap at 200 sections; paginate beyond that. Webhook callbacks fire on completion only — no progress events yet, slated for next sprint. Latency target is under 90 seconds for a full week schedule. Test against the staging cluster before Friday's sync. Authenticate staging calls with the bearer token below.

bearer token for fajep-baweg: eyJhbGciOiJIUzI1NiIsInR5cCI6IkpXVCJ9.eyJzdWIiOiIdKhH9AIn0.y1MY7Bj2

### Soft deletes on `orders` (Brackenhill checkout)

Quick context before you review: we're not hard-deleting rows anymore because refunds reference orders up to 180 days out. Instead we set `deleted_at` and filter in a view, then a nightly reaper purges rows past retention. Yes, this bloats the table a bit — the reaper batch sizes keep vacuum happy. The retention windows and batch limits are pinned in the constants below.

tuning constants:
QUOTAS = {
    "druwyn": 5,
    "holix": 5,
    "zorath": 5,
    "holwyn": 10,
}

## Releases — Nightwell Scheduler

Nightwell cuts a release every other Thursday, right after the backfill queue drains. Tag from main, let CI build the scheduler image, and sanity-check one dry-run backfill against the Corvale staging lake. If that passes, promote it. Promoted images must be signed, so grab the deploy key below and you're set.

release key, hadug-kawef: bky13_mPGeFZeR1GZ1G